A budget hotel a short walk to the town centre. My double room was clean with a great view of the Chilterns. The bed was firm with good quality linen. The shower was hot with plenty of pressure. Just what I needed. The staff were helpful and let me keep my expensive bicycle in my room, which I really appreciated. Breakfast was as advertised. Grab and go. Plenty of bacon for a big roll. A bit of fruit and a muffin, all washed down with some pretty decent filter coffee. This place ticked all the boxes I wanted it to.

Initial impressions were good - great location (5 min walk to town centre), plenty of on-site parking and friendly greeting and check in. Room and hotel generally tired. No sound-proofing - people in room above seemed to drop shoes, bags, etc onto their floor and very thin walls so kept awake by noisy neighbours who were channel hopping tv and talking loudly over it until around 2 am. Breakfast was unappetising and bland - two keep-warm metal containers of bacon to put into burger type buns and some squashed croissants, some of which were individually packed and some open to the fly which was buzzing around.

upon arrival, we were greeted by a very lovely man who was willing to help with anything especially when we went out to get food and he assured us that he would be there all night, the cold drinks fridge in reception was a nice touch too. |the room was mediocre at best, for a family room it was very cramped and there was a wonky, wobbly shelving unit placed right in front of the door which we walked into straight away. |good selection of tea and coffee, mugs and glasses were clean. |bathroom was very dated and in desperate need of a refurbishment as there was a leaky tap and a broken toilet seat. |bed looked clean but smelt like chip fat so we had to spray it before going to sleep, mattress was incredibly hard and the pillows were paper thin, as were the walls. Luckily i brought earplugs with me however the other people in my room complained about how you can hear everyone’s TVs and conversations at night. |the breakfast was absolutely GRIM, eggs looked like they’d been there for months and did not taste like eggs at all, bacon was rock solid and you couldn’t get a knife in it if you tried, beans and mushrooms weren’t that bad but cold by 8am since breakfast starts at 6:30am. good selection of juice and tea was good quality, toast was cheap quality however. |the hotel is in a good location though and easy to get to shopping centre, pubs and the train station. |moderately good value for money but would not come back

The Abbey Lodge Hotel was our choice of stay in High Wycombe simply because of the price. To be completely honest, when we arrived I was surprised. |Plenty of free parking behind the hotel, in the reception ( which is manned 24hrs) is a fridge for cold drinks, which you ask the staff for. The bottled water is £1 and varied soft drinks at £2.|We were greeted by a very cheerful lady, who let us check in at 12 instead of 2, which again is surprising .|Our room was a nice size, with a double bed, 2 bedside cabinets, flat screen tv , tea / coffee facility and aircon. Shower over bath with toiletries and towels supplied. The bed was really comfortable.|Breakfast is pretty standard of cooked or cereals and is self service in a basement dining room|Located really close to the town centre but don't believe apple maps because it says a 17 minute walk, just go out the front door, turn right and 5 minutes ( at most) later, you are in town.|All of the staff we encountered were lovely.|All in all an excellent place to stay

Underrated hotel, arguably the best in the area with a few caveats. The facilities are visibily dated and haven't been refurbished in years - but all the main things like bedding, cups, bathroom etc were immaculate. The location is great and I think it's the only hotel in the center with free parking, but the hill it's on is not for the faint hearted. My only other issue was the shower because the water took ages to heat up and the head was criminally small. Definitely worth the price, and could do so much better with a bit of fresh paint and new decor.
